E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
Alibaba微服务架构
docker consul容器的自动发现与注册
一、微服务(容器)的注册与发现——
微服务架构
中极其重要的组件1、定义:是一种分布式管理系统以及定位服务的方法。
咩咩230
·
2023-12-18 18:07
docker
consul
容器
Arthas安装及简单使用
一.背景介绍Arthas是
Alibaba
在2018年9月开源的Java诊断工具。支持JDK6+,采用命令行交互模式,提供Tab自动补全,可以方便的定位和诊断线上程序运行问题。
爷一隐居青楼
·
2023-12-18 18:04
java
springboot获取nacos的服务列表、实例列表及修改实例、发布配置等
sdk.htmlhttps://nacos.io/zh-cn/docs/open-api.html1.1构造ConfigService工具类packagecom.redxun.config;importcom.
alibaba
.nacos.api.config.ConfigService
今年下半年
·
2023-12-18 18:24
spring
boot
nacos
java-sdk
open-api
【nacos】nacos配置中心自制工具类 获取配置dataid级全文 不使用自带注入和refresh 观察者+监听器实现
importcn.exrick.xboot.common.utils.SpringContextUtil;importcn.hutool.core.collection.CollUtil;importcom.
alibaba
.cloud.nacos
why why?
·
2023-12-18 18:53
java
spring
spring
boot
maven
Spring Cloud + Spring Cloud
Alibaba
第三天
父工程pom文件中dependencyManagement和dependencies的区别在上一篇文章中,我们创建完成了父工程,同时也编写了父工程的pom文件,有一点需要注意的是,父工程的pom文件中,引用使用的关键词为dependencyManagement而不是dependencies,那么他们有什么区别呢?dependencyManagement一般用在父模块,子模块继承之后:锁定版本+子模
西二旗C罗
·
2023-12-18 15:27
Spring
Cloud
+
Spring
Alibaba
spring
cloud
java
maven
微服务是什么?
微服务架构
使应用程序更易于扩展和更快地开发,从而加速创新并缩短新功能的上市时间。整体式架构与
微服务架构
vs
微服务架构
通过整体式架构,所有进程紧密耦合,并可作为单项服务运行。
不怕娜
·
2023-12-18 12:53
微服务
大数据
架构
从外包公司到今日头条offer,讲的太清楚了
近日,经过一朋友的透露,
Alibaba
也首发了一份限量的“Java成长笔记”,里面记载的知识点非常齐全,看完之后才知道,差距真的不止一点点!Java成长笔记主要是将Java程序
Java德克士
·
2023-12-18 12:04
程序员
java
后端
面试
Java集成socket.io
前言本文基于SpringBoot2.2.6,集成netty-socketio依赖com.corundumstudio.socketionetty-socketio1.7.7com.
alibaba
fastjson1.2.4
朝花不迟暮
·
2023-12-18 11:25
SpringBoot
socket
websocket
CentOS 7 部署 Nacos-2.3.0 (单机版)
CentOS7部署Nacos-2.3.0(单机版)1.下载Nacos安装包历史版本:https://github.com/
alibaba
/nacos/releases/我选的是2.3.0版本,https
冰阔落好喝Wow
·
2023-12-18 08:38
centos
linux
运维
Serverless:
微服务架构
的终极模式
微服务的生态和实践已经比较成熟,其设计方法、开发框架、CI/CD工具、基础设施管理工具等,都可以帮助企业顺利实施微服务。然而,微服务远没有达到完美,它在架构、开发、基础设施方面仍然面临新的挑战。微服务面临的挑战微服务的粒度影响服务的交付速度及扩展性,微服务的开发引入治理组件,增加了开发的难度,以容器为基础的微服务基础设施在弹性等方面仍有不足,而微服务增加带来的基础设施成本也是微服务实施的新挑战。1
博文视点
·
2023-12-18 07:08
博文视点IT荐书吧
数据库
postgresql
sql
【SpringBoot零基础入门到项目实战①】解锁现代Java开发之门:深度探究Spring Boot的背景、目标及选择理由
文章目录引言SpringBoot的背景和目标背景目标为什么选择SpringBoot1.简化配置2.内嵌式容器3.生态系统支持4.大量的Starter5.广泛的社区支持6.适用于
微服务架构
7.丰富的扩展机制实例演示创建一个简单的
IT·陈寒
·
2023-12-18 07:54
SpringBoot框架学习
java
spring
boot
后端
spring cloud集成seata分布式事务(eureka注册中心)
在
微服务架构
应用中,有一些业务场景要求数据的强一致性,这就促进了分布式事务的产生。ps:大部分应用场景是不建议使用分布式事务的,分布式事务效率会比较低。
梦想实现家_Z
·
2023-12-18 07:14
Alibaba
分布式事务组件Seata AT实战
1.分布式事务简介1.1本地事务大多数场景下,我们的应用都只需要操作单一的数据库,这种情况下的事务称之为本地事务(LocalTransaction)。本地事务的ACID特性是数据库直接提供支持。本地事务应用架构如下所示:在JDBC编程中,我们通过java.sql.Connection对象来开启、关闭或者提交事务。代码如下所示:Connectionconn=...//获取数据库连接conn.setA
会code的厨子
·
2023-12-18 06:24
分布式
Alibaba
分布式事务组件Seata XA&TCC实战
1.SeataXA模式实战XA协议最主要的作用是就是定义了RM-TM的交互接口,XA规范除了定义的RM-TM交互的接口(XAInterface)之外,还对两阶段提交协议进行了优化。1.1整体机制在Seata定义的分布式事务框架内,利用事务资源(数据库、消息服务等)对XA协议的支持,以XA协议的机制来管理分支事务的一种事务模式。执行阶段:可回滚:业务SQL操作放在XA分支中进行,由资源对XA协议的支
会code的厨子
·
2023-12-18 06:24
分布式
java
架构
微服务
微服务链路追踪组件Skywalking实战
微服务链路追踪组件Skywalking实战skywalking版本:v9.1.0对于一个大型的几十个、几百个微服务构成的
微服务架构
系统,通常会遇到下面一些问题,比如:如何串联整个调用链路,快速定位问题?
会code的厨子
·
2023-12-18 06:47
Skywalking
微服务
skywalking
架构
RocketMQ系统性学习-SpringCloud
Alibaba
集成RocketMQ以及批量发送消息、消息过滤实战
文章目录批量发送消息消息过滤批量发送消息批量发送消息可以减少网络的IO开销,让多个消息通过1次网络开销就可以发送,提升数据发送的吞吐量虽然批量发送消息可以减少网络IO开销,但是一次也不能发送太多消息批量消息直接将多个消息放入集合中发送即可,生产者代码如下:publicclassProducer{publicstaticvoidmain(String[]args)throwsException{//
11来了
·
2023-12-18 06:41
RocketMQ
rocketmq
学习
spring
cloud
基于Angular4和Spring Cloud的前后端分离技术
一、概述
微服务架构
是一种新的软件体系设计形式,提倡将应用系统按照一定的原则将大系统拆分成一系列细小的服务,每个服务只需要专注于一个单一的业务功能即可,并且服务之间可以互相独立运行,采用轻量级API进行通信
sknfie
·
2023-12-18 05:03
配置管理Nacos-config
启动配置管理1.添加依赖:org.springframework.bootspring-boot-startercom.
alibaba
.cloudspring-cloud-starter-
alibaba
-nacos-config2
NeuBLUE
·
2023-12-18 04:24
springcloud
alibaba
01
整合springcloud和springcloud
alibaba
,,,版本对应关系org.springframework.cloudspring-cloud-dependenciesHoxton.SR12pomimportorg.springframework.cloudspring-cloud-
alibaba
-dependencies0.9.0
waterkid0
·
2023-12-18 04:32
springcloud
springcloud
手动构建最新版本的Nacos镜像 并通过docker-compose 运行
github.com/nacos-group/nacos-docker)后边加.git直接拉取可以跳过墙2.下载最新版本的Nacos包放在build文件夹下[版本汇总地址](https://github.com/
alibaba
码农20年
·
2023-12-18 03:14
docker
容器
运维
EasyExcel复杂模板导出
EasyExcel复杂模板导出1.引入依赖com.
alibaba
easyexcel3.0.2compile注意事项:当项目中使用过poi时,引入easyexcel需要将easyexcel中的poi进行排除
总会有好的时候吧
·
2023-12-18 02:27
java
开发语言
Easy Excel读取复杂表格文件
实现逻辑1.前期准备1)Pom文件引入EasyExcelcom.
alibaba
easyexcel3.0.52)实现AnalysisEventListenerpubli
MMO_
·
2023-12-18 02:56
java
java
Java使用EasyExcel导出简单、复杂excel,以及多个excel打包导出下载zip
EasyExcel是一款阿里开源的一款非常优秀Excel导入导出工具,使用内存小,处理速度快,使用方便,正好最近项目中有用到多个excel导出下载的功能,便记录下EasyExcel使用git地址:GitHub-
alibaba
老醋先生~
·
2023-12-18 02:55
java
java
【Easyexcel】根据模板导出excel
1.版本:Maven:com.
alibaba
:easyexcel:3.0.52.代码实现ExportExcelBase:是定义一些非列表的字段,如下:导出时间等工具类:;importcom.
alibaba
.excel.EasyExcel
飞四海
·
2023-12-18 01:54
框架
excel
java
servlet
EasyExcel使用模板导出复杂Excel
1)添加easyexlce的依赖com.
alibaba
easyexcel3.0.0-beta12)添加excel模板文件实现的效果:3)导出@GetMapping("/export/use/template
若鱼1919
·
2023-12-18 01:52
excel
java
Spring Cloud
Alibaba
Sentinel无法加载到Nacos中的规则配置解决方案
SpringCloud
Alibaba
Sentinel在配置规则持久化时,按照官网的教程使用nacos作为数据源来配置,但在完成后,启动应用并调了一次接口后,发现sentinel-dashboard控制台并没有加载到
指尖凉
·
2023-12-18 01:59
Spring
Cloud
Alibaba
Sentinel
AndroidStudio 优秀插件推荐
AndroidStudio插件推荐一、插件列表1.
Alibaba
JavaCodingGuidelines2.AndroidButterKnifeInjections(SupportKotlin)3.GsonFormat4
x024
·
2023-12-18 01:52
Android
Android
AndroidStudio
AndroidStudio插件
插件
Plugins
Docker容器编排技术解析
随着
微服务架构
的兴起和应用的复杂性增加,容器编排成为了实现高效、可靠和动态服务管理的关键技术。容器编排的概念和重要性容器编排的概念源自于需要在大量的物理或虚拟机上有效管理成百上千个容器的需求。
胖头鱼不吃鱼-
·
2023-12-18 00:06
docker
容器
运维
Java执行jar包中的某个类的main方法
文件更新成如下内容4.0.0xiangyoukeji.gis.zrcJmeterTestResult0.1JmeterTestResultDemoprojectforSpringBoot1.8com.
alibaba
fastjson1.2.62commons-iocommons-io2.4org.apache.commonscommons
扶剑_1688
·
2023-12-17 23:14
云计算架构师高级认证考试攻略
阿里云云计算架构师高级认证考试(ACE)阿里云云计算架构师高级认证(
Alibaba
CloudCertifiedExpert–CloudArchitect)是验证参考人员利用阿里云平台,合理、有效的设计和部署具有高扩展性
xmvip01
·
2023-12-17 22:10
SOA和微服务的区别
2.
微服务架构
:其实和SOA架构类似,微服务是在SOA上做的升华,
微服务架构
强调的一个
写代码的杰西
·
2023-12-17 22:04
Docker是什么-看这一篇就够了
Docker很快在DevOps中获得了如此多的普及和采用,因为它是为可移植性而开发的,并且是为现代
微服务架构
而设计的。在这篇博客中,您将了解到,什么是Docker?了解D
yule.yang
·
2023-12-17 22:07
云原生
docker
容器
运维
SpringBoot + EasyExcel(
Alibaba
) 读操作,将Excel文件上传至数据库
点击跳转至官方文档引入依赖com.
alibaba
easyexcel2.2.6Excel实例配置实体类主要就
小刘爱搬砖
·
2023-12-17 22:49
SpringBoot
easyexcel
文件上传
JAVA架构知识总结
EurekaConfigHystrixGeteWaySlueth链路追踪[springcloud
alibaba
](https://b
神科
·
2023-12-17 21:42
java开发经验
JAVA
Android高级-阿里VLayout使用和原理分析
使用:implementation'com.
alibaba
.and
芒果_BJ
·
2023-12-17 21:25
微服务
一、什么是微服务
微服务架构
风格是一种将单个应用程序作为一套小型服务开发的方法,每种应用程序都在自己的进程中运行,并与轻量级机制(通常是基于HTTP的RESTfulAPI)进行通信。
shumeigang
·
2023-12-17 20:22
SpringBoot
SpringCloud
Spring
微服务网关gateway
简述SpringCloudGateway是SpringCloud的一个子项目,该项目是基于Spring5.0,SpringBoot2.0和ProjectReactor等技术开发的网关,它旨在为
微服务架构
提供一种简单有效的统一的
LallanaLee
·
2023-12-17 20:27
网关
gateway
解决Cannot resolve com.
alibaba
.cloud:aliyun-oss-spring-boot-starter:unknown 文件上传报错aliCloudEdasSdk解决
1.解决unknown:com.
alibaba
.cloudspring-cloud-
alibaba
-dependencies2.2.3.RELEASEpomimportcom.
alibaba
.cloudaliyun-oss-spring-boot-starter1.0.0pomimport2
cevent
·
2023-12-17 20:56
springboot
mybatis
阿里云OSS
java
spring
阿里云
mysql
maven
Maven问题总结
.blog.51cto.com/1081650/364072http://tianya23.blog.51cto.com/1081650/386891maven安装配置:http://b2b-doc.
alibaba
-inc.com
Snoopy7713
·
2023-12-17 20:54
Maven
maven
问题
Docker-consule 服务发现与注册
consul服务更新和服务发现什么是服务注册与发现服务注册与发现是
微服务架构
中不可或缺的重要组件。起初服务都是单节点的,不保障高可用性,也不考虑服务的压力承载,服务之间调用单纯的通过接口访问。
m0_70766460
·
2023-12-17 19:00
docker
容器
运维
【springboot】【easyexcel】excel文件读取
目录pom.xmlExcelVo逐行读取并处理全部读取并处理向ExcelListener传参pom.xmlcom.
alibaba
easyexcel3.1.1ExcelVo字段映射@DatapublicclassExcelVo
lorogy
·
2023-12-17 18:31
后端
spring
boot
excel
java
idea__SpringBoot微服务11——整合Druid数据源(新依赖)(新注解)
ConfigurationProperties@ConfigurationProperties(prefix=“spring.datasource”):作用就是将全局配置文件中前缀为spring.datasource的属性值注入到com.
alibaba
.dr
五月CG
·
2023-12-17 18:12
springboot
intellij-idea
spring
boot
微服务
druid
40张图看懂分布式追踪系统原理及实践
前言在
微服务架构
中,一次请求往往涉及到多个模块,多个中间件,多台机器的相互协作才能完成。
ღ᭄陽先生꧔ꦿ᭄
·
2023-12-17 18:57
分布式
我以为自己MySQL够牛逼了,直到看到了
Alibaba
的面试题
前言众所周知,简历上“了解=听过名字;熟悉=知道是啥;熟练=用过;精通=做过东西”。(文末有跳槽涨薪福利)相信大家对于MySQL的索引都不陌生,索引(Index)是帮助MySQL高效获取数据的数据结构。索引作为MySQL中比较重点的知识,在面试中出现的频率特别高。本人自认为对MySQL的索引知识相当了解,同事们工作中也都热情的称呼我为大佬。为了进阿里,我特地花了1个月左右时间复习相关知识,自信满满
吃井不忘挖水人呢
·
2023-12-17 17:56
IDEA上传jar包到Maven
mvninstall:install-file//固定格式,maven的语法-Dfile=
alibaba
-sdk-1.0.0.jar//这里填写包的路径,因为我们是在当前目录所以只需要输入包名即可-DgroupId
小鸡会蹦迪
·
2023-12-17 13:00
intellij-idea
jar
maven
Ruoyi微服务部署问题记录,Client not connected, current status:STARTING
我在服务器上部署了一个
alibaba
的nacos-2.2.0配置中心、注册中心。然后在本地运行Ruoyi微服务的时候,使用了服务器上的nacos地址。121.36.97.XXX:8848。
拈㕦一笑
·
2023-12-17 13:46
微服务
java
springcloud
alibaba
-Sentinel
文章目录一.前置知识1.雪崩问题2.服务保护技术对比二.Sentinel三.微服务整合Sentinel1.限流规则1.流控模式2.流控效果热点参数限流(更细粒度的限流方式)2.隔离和降级Feign整合Sentinel1.线程隔离2.熔断降级3.授权规则4.规则持久化一.前置知识1.雪崩问题设想一下以下场景:服务A需要调用服务D实现某种功能,但服务D因为某种原因宕机了,导致请求服务A实现调用服务D的
p1sto
·
2023-12-17 13:43
spring
cloud
sentinel
spring
后端
nacos
微服务架构
下的分布式事务
系统软件为了实现一定的业务,会将现实中的人、事、物进行抽象表示,并将其映射为系统中的模型。业务模型大致可以按以下来构建:1、定义系统中应该存在哪些实体、实体上有哪些属性。2、定义实体之间的各种拓扑关系,如从属、嵌套、多对多。3、定义实体和属性的动态关系,即定义系统流程第1、2步是静态的,因此可以用E-R图(实体-关系图)来表示,它能够描述系统在某个时间节点所有可能的状态,第3步需要用流程图和“状态
WongKyunban
·
2023-12-17 13:38
微服务
架构
微服务
分布式
java版spring cloud熔断器Hystrix
1.熔断器服务雪崩在正常的
微服务架构
体系下,一个业务很少有只需要调用一个服务就可以返回数据的情况,这种比较常见的是出现在demo中,一般都是存在调用链的,比如A->B->C->D,如果D在某一个瞬间出现问题
fumi106
·
2023-12-17 12:04
如何搭建Gateway服务
的简单介绍SpringCloudGateway是SpringCloud的一个项目,该项目是基于Spring,SpringBoot和ProjectReactor等响应式编程和事件流技术开发的网关,它旨在为
微服务架构
提供一种简单有效的统一的
upton-nan
·
2023-12-17 11:12
gateway
上一页
35
36
37
38
39
40
41
42
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他